Textbook that reads like narrative history
I studied Russian history in graduate school. This book served as my go-to secondary source for decades, and still does today in its 9th edition.Its scope is truly magisterial. The style is profound but is also easily accessible. Really, you should probably take the book in small bites rather than trying to blast through. Savor all those facts and critical interpretations.No branch of history is neglected. It's all here. Economic, political, cultural, military, religion, literally everything finds its way into the volume. Important political and cultural movements are discussed with intelligence and insight. Excellent overview of Russian history
I highly recommend this rich and detailed account of Russian history from Middle Ages before it existed as a nation state through the early Tsars, Russian empire, the Revolution, Communism, its collapse, Yeltsin and Putin. This is a great primer for context around current events or if you enjoy reading Russian literature by Tolstoy or Dostoyevsky.A word of caution, this book is a university publisher text book, so it's for readers who are smart enough to handle academic writing without getting overwhelmed.

Lousy Binding for a Very Expensive Book!
Having read several earlier editions, I eagerly awaited this Ninth Edition, and planned to use it for a class I teach this Fall. It is the best concise, one-volume work on Russia. It achieves both balance and readability. BUT, the binding was so weak that pages and pages fell out of the book. Alas, I should have checked it carefully first, because it is not returnable after a few notes I made in it before the flaws were revealed.
